当前位置: 首页 > 工具软件 > OmniFind > 使用案例 >

如何理解OmniFind Edition中的IDS

洪璞瑜
2023-12-01

在Omnifind中有两种ID,分别是:ApplicationID,CollectionID;而在WASND中会有个Application是ESSearchServer,很多人会认为ApplicationID所指的是ESSearchServer,如果没有详细的编程指南(Omnifind随机附赠的编程指南中是没有的),我在IBM在线的编程指南中找到了这个定义,指得是Omnifind Admin Console中看见的应用程序,即Default;在建立类似的应用程序时是无法设置密码的,也就是编程时需要的ApplicationPWD,怎么办?在在线指南中找到了答案,把密码设为:null,呵呵,这真够绝的.

经过一段时间的学习,清楚了一些东西,明天还需要弄清楚collectionname和collectionid之间的关系.这个很重要,关系到搜索域,如果没有相关的知识是无法搜索的.

再一个问题就是,我发现Omnifind自带的ESSearchApplication应用程序是无法直接学习的,我仔细研究过,内部代码的实现很多是使用struts和portal相关的tag编程的.汗~~~

我肯定不能学那些了,我需要通过学习Omnifind提供的api直接编写需要的功能,再由一个难点就是DataListener需要好好研究一下.

 类似资料: